Dancehall Music's Evolution: Where Truth Meets Rhythm

Dancehall music, a vibrant form of island popular entertainment, has undergone a significant transformation since its beginnings in the late 1980s. Initially a raw, MC-driven offshoot of reggae, it rapidly evolved into a distinct sonic landscape characterized by faster tempos, energetic rhythms, and direct lyrical content. The early sounds, often reflecting the everyday realities of inner-city Jamaica, spoke truth to power, confronting issues like poverty, police brutality, and community injustice. This authentic storytelling element remains a central characteristic, even as the scene has branched out, incorporating influences of hip-hop, pop, and electronic music . Today’s dancehall artists continue to leverage the rhythmic foundations of the past while pushing boundaries and resonating with global audiences, ensuring its influence endures.
